PROS(PRO) - 2025 Q1 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-05-01 21:47
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company reported a 14% year-over-year growth in trailing twelve-month recurring calculated billings, marking the strongest performance in ten quarters [7] - Free cash flow improved by 123% year-over-year, reaching $1,100,000 in the first quarter [7][19] - Subscription revenue increased to $70,800,000, up 10% year-over-year, while total revenue reached $86,300,000, up 7% year-over-year [20] - Non-GAAP earnings per share for the first quarter was $0.13, exceeding guidance [23]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- Recurring revenue constituted 85% of total revenue, an increase from 84% in the same quarter last year [20] - Non-GAAP subscription gross margin improved to 81%, up over 160 basis points year-over-year [21] - Non-GAAP services gross margin was reported at 13%, an improvement of over 460 basis points year-over-year [21]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company experienced strong demand in the travel sector, winning contracts with two of the top seven US carriers [13][30] - The ongoing market volatility has led to increased adoption of AI-powered pricing and selling solutions, with companies recognizing the need for real-time data-driven decisions [11][12]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focusing on AI-powered solutions to enhance sales efficiency and customer experience, positioning itself as a market leader in this space [14][15] - The upcoming Outperform conference will showcase the latest AI innovations, emphasizing the company's commitment to responsible AI development [15][74]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management noted that the current macroeconomic environment is complex but has not negatively impacted demand; instead, there is an increase in inbound demand and meetings booked [33][34] - The company maintains its full-year guidance despite the positive trends, citing the need to remain cautious due to macro risks [66] Other Important Information - The company announced the planned retirement of its CEO, with Jeff Cotton set to take over as president and CEO [16][17] - The company exited the first quarter with $170,000,000 in cash and investments [22] Q&A Session Summary Question: Insights on the bookings environment and travel segment - Management indicated improvements in the travel segment, with innovations resonating well and contributing to strong performance [30] Question: Impact of the current macro environment on business - Management stated that the complex selling environment has not hindered demand; instead, companies are accelerating initiatives [32][34] Question: Clarification on gross margin improvements - Management explained that efficiencies in cloud solutions and automation in services have driven better gross margins [39][40] Question: Breakdown of revenue guidance between new and existing customers - Management provided a 40-60 split between new and existing customers, indicating a consistent mix moving forward [51] Question: Changes in go-to-market strategy contributing to improved bookings - Management highlighted improvements in sales execution, productivity, and marketing functions as key contributors to the positive trend [54]
